Justine Bateman’s Background and Career
Before diving into the latest discussions, it’s essential to understand who Justine Bateman is and why her opinion matters. She rose to fame in the 1980s with her role as Mallory Keaton in the popular sitcomFamily Ties. Her performance earned her critical acclaim and a dedicated fan base. Over the years, she expanded her career to include writing, directing, and producing, making her a multifaceted figure in the entertainment world.
From Actress to Advocate
After decades in front of the camera, Bateman shifted her focus toward writing and filmmaking, using these platforms to address important social issues. Her books, such asFace: One Square Foot of Skin, challenge societal beauty norms and examine the pressure to remain youthful in Hollywood. These themes often come up in her interviews, including those aired or discussed on Fox News.
What Sparked the Fox News Discussion?
The phrase Fox News Justine Bateman often trends when the network covers her candid remarks about aging and plastic surgery. In a widely discussed segment, Bateman shared that she refuses to undergo cosmetic procedures, even in an industry obsessed with appearance. She expressed that she feels confident and happy with her natural face, sending a message of self-acceptance that struck a chord with many viewers.
Key Points Highlighted in the Interview
- Justine Bateman believes that beauty standards have become unrealistic and harmful.
- She argues that cosmetic surgery often stems from fear, not self-love.
- Her decision to age naturally is rooted in confidence and authenticity rather than rebellion.
